About the style 2 Bantam
The Bantam model was introduced in April of
1931. The first design (style 1) featured peg legs.
Style 2 changed from peg legs to a base and was introduced
in August of 1932. The style 2 was made until August
of 1934.

Features:
The Bantam rings the alarm on an internal
bell. The alarm set is a switch on the back of the
clock, near the top. The Bantam used the Westclox
series 66 movement, which was produced until 1956. |
